Ver Mensaje Individual
  #15 (permalink)  
Antiguo 06/12/2013, 13:09
Avatar de guardarmicorreo
guardarmicorreo
 
Fecha de Ingreso: noviembre-2012
Ubicación: Córdoba
Mensajes: 1.153
Antigüedad: 12 años
Puntos: 84
Respuesta: Idiomas en la web, como lograrlo?

creo que aquí hay mezclados varios temas y eso no conduce a nada.

empezando por tu problema con las fechas:

no puedes poner en el case de diciembre que la variable $mes pueda valer 12 pero luego le pases el string Diciembre porque entonces nunca encontrará dicha igualdad.

tienes un problema estructural en el código:

no puedes pasarles números enteros y de repente un array. eso hace que tu código sea muy limitado en tanto que:

-para llegar al mes de diciembre $mes tendrá que ser un array.
-si ese array no fue tratado antes del switch case entonces no llegará nunca al mes que esperas.
-en otro ambiente donde tengas que utilizar la función para los meses tendrás que adaptar tu código de manera que para 11 meses pases valores enteros y para diciembre un array.

esas tres cosas te pueden dar muchísimos dolores de cabeza.

el formato en inglés no es el formato en español. en eso estamos de acuerdo.

si estás trabajando con código funcional y no orientado a objetos, entonces tendrás que crear dos funciones distintas, una para cada formato.

Dalam, lo que dijo marlanga ha quedado probado que leonaryoel no lo necesita.
¿para qué tener código de más utilizando una librería de otro programador que va a contener funcionalidades que él no necesita haciendo el directorio de la web más pesado e invirtiendo tiempo en aprender sobre el código adquirido?

lamentablemente hoy día los traductores disponibles no sirven en muchos ámbitos. no acaparan lenguajes técnicos y la traslación (no la traducción literal) de un idioma a otro en muchísimos casos es tremendamente pobre. por eso esta medida sería más bien para presentar un contenido que no sea relevante y puede que el resultado logre más impresiones negativas que positivas hacia el usuario final. sea google, yahoo, bing, el que sea, ninguno sirve para dicho fin si se quiere tener un contenido bien presentado, como debe ser.
__________________
Ayúdame a hacerlo por mi mismo.